The first thing to look at is your washing technique. Contrary to thinking, acne is not caused by poor hygiene, but it can be made worse by how we wash. Harsh soaps, scented soaps, and antibacterial soaps are murder on the skin, especially the face. Washing and rubbing with a face clothe or any exfoliate material like loofas makes acne even worse. Just be kind and gentle to your skin. It is inflamed and infected, it needs loving care. So, when you wash, use just your hands, a mild soap, rinse well, and pat dry. Then if you choose, apply an acne medication.

Nutrition and hydration go hand in hand with acne control. Good skin loves nutrition food, with lots of fruit, veggies and whole grain. It also loves lots of hydration, so drink plenty of water. You might think that water in the form of caffeinated drinks is good - not so. Caffeine dehydrates - very hard on the skin.

Do you exercise? I am not talking about marathon gym sessions, or running 5 miles a day. A simple brisk walk for 20 minutes will do your skin wonders. Exercise increases blood flow to the skin which helps rejuvenation by oxygenation. Your skin is crying out for it. Not only will it help fight the acne, it will give you a healthy glow.

Stress is a tough one. It does go hand in hand with today's hectic lifestyle, but stress absolutely makes your acne worse. One of the things that aggravates acne is stress. When we feel under pressure, stress hormones are released in our bodies. These hormones actually help us to cope better in stressful situations, too bad they wreck havoc with our skin. Avoiding stress takes practice, but it can be done.

All of these measures will help you control acne, but they will not prevent it. Nor are they a total guarantee that you won't get a good bought of it. It your acne is so bad that you can't keep it under control, then by all means, see a doctor for advise.
